English meaning
Senses
equino is used for these senses in English:
- equine Of or relating to a horse or horses.
- equine Any horse or horse-like animal, especially one of the genus Equus.
- horse (dated, slang, among students) A translation or other illegitimate aid in study or examination.
- sea urchin Any of many marine echinoderms, of the class Echinoidea, commonly found in shallow water, having a complex chewing structure named Aristotle's lantern.
